#3dc59c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3dc59c is composed of 23.9% red, 77.3%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.8%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 161.9 degrees, a saturation of 54% and a lightness of 50.6%. #3dc59c color hex could be obtained by blending #7affff with #008b39.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

#3dc59c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3dc59c has RGB values of R:61, G:197,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.21,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 4048284.
